We are in search of a Linux Systems Administrator to:
- Install, configure, and network UNIX and/or NT based platforms.
- Create, modify and delete user accounts, performing system back-ups, and maintaining system configuration files.
- Demonstrate a fundamental understanding of operating systems and be familiar with either UNIX or NT commands or utilities at the user level.
- Install and configure hardware, operating systems, and commercial software packages.
- Develop and implement enterprise backup/recovery strategies, server configuration and consolidation, and verification of the health and status of the entire IT infrastructure.
- Provide support for enterprise services such as DNS, NFS, e-mail services, security protection mechanisms, and the interoperability of UNIX and NT based systems.

Required Skills and Education
- TS/SCI clearance with appropriate poly
- Ability to work 100% onsite
- The ideal candidates shall have a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science or related field and have eight (8) years of demonstrable experience in system administration and support of a large client-server based IT enterprise.
- Or the individual shall have five (5) years of full-time computer science work that can be substituted for the Bachelor’s Degree, and have eight (8) years of demonstrable experience in system administration and support of a large client-server based IT enterprise. An industry recognized professional certification may substitute as one year experience.
- Experience shall include installation, configuration, and networking of UNIX and/or NT based platforms. This experience shall include:
- Creating, modifying and deleting user accounts, performing system back-ups, and maintaining system configuration files.
- Fundamental understanding of operating systems ad be familiar with either UNIX or NT commands or utilities at the user level.
- Experience shall include the installation and configuration of hardware, operating systems, and commercial software packages.
- Ability to develop and implement enterprise backup/recovery strategies, server configuration and consolidation, and verification of the health and status of the entire IT infrastructure.
- Ability to provide support for enterprise services such as DNS, NFS, e-mail services, security protection mechanisms, and the interoperability of UNIX and NT based systems.
- Experience with:
- Servers running Sparc Solaris, SolarisX64, red Hat, and SuSe, with direct attached and FC SAN storage
- Client server technology utilizing NFS and CIFS
- Large memory SMP systems with many cores
- Enterprise client server configurations
- Multi-vendor filesystems such as XFS, GPFS, and CXFS
- Fielded systems
- Blade systems and associated interconnects (SAD, FC, TCP/IP, etc.)
- Red Hat and Microsoft Windows Operating System
- Microsoft Exchange
- Centrify
- Infrastructure support services such as DNS, NIS, Active Directory, Centrify, Zenoss, SiteScope, HP Openview, HPSA, HPSE, Splunk, Sendmail, Exchange, NetQoS, Infoblox
- Thin client solutions based on Virtual bridges and Centrix
- NoMachine NX
- Virtualizing products; VMWare and Solaris containers
- Accepted professional certifications include:
- Possess a valid RHCSA or higher Red Hat certification
- IAT Level II Certification Required
